黑狐家游戏

基于Python的网站留言短信通知系统源码详解及实现步骤,网站留言短信通知 源码怎么设置

欧气 0 0

本文目录导读:

基于Python的网站留言短信通知系统源码详解及实现步骤,网站留言短信通知 源码怎么设置

图片来源于网络,如有侵权联系删除

  1. 系统概述
  2. 技术选型
  3. 实现步骤
  4. 系统测试

随着互联网的快速发展,网站留言功能已经成为各大网站不可或缺的一部分,当用户在网站上留言后,如何及时通知管理员或相关责任人,以确保留言得到及时处理,成为了一个亟待解决的问题,本文将详细介绍一款基于Python的网站留言短信通知系统源码,并详细阐述其实现步骤。

系统概述

本系统采用Python编程语言,结合短信发送接口和网站留言功能,实现用户在网站留言后,自动发送短信通知管理员的功能,系统主要由以下模块组成:

1、数据库模块:用于存储网站留言信息和用户信息。

2、网站留言模块:用于接收用户留言,并存储到数据库中。

3、短信发送模块:用于将短信发送给管理员。

4、通知模块:用于将网站留言信息发送给管理员。

技术选型

1、Python:作为主要编程语言,具有丰富的库和框架,便于实现各种功能。

2、MySQL:作为数据库,用于存储网站留言信息和用户信息。

3、Twilio API:作为短信发送接口,实现短信发送功能。

4、Flask:作为Web框架,用于实现网站留言功能。

基于Python的网站留言短信通知系统源码详解及实现步骤,网站留言短信通知 源码怎么设置

图片来源于网络,如有侵权联系删除

实现步骤

1、数据库设计

设计数据库表结构,包括用户表、留言表和短信通知表,用户表存储用户信息,留言表存储留言内容,短信通知表存储短信发送记录。

2、用户注册与登录

使用Flask框架实现用户注册与登录功能,用户注册后,将其信息存储到数据库中,登录时,验证用户名和密码,若验证成功,则允许用户访问网站。

3、网站留言功能

实现网站留言功能,包括留言内容的输入、提交和存储,用户在网站上留言后,留言信息将存储到数据库中的留言表中。

4、短信发送模块

利用Twilio API实现短信发送功能,在短信发送模块中,设置发送短信的手机号码和验证码,将短信发送给管理员。

5、通知模块

当用户在网站上留言后,通知模块将自动将留言信息发送给管理员,具体实现方式如下:

基于Python的网站留言短信通知系统源码详解及实现步骤,网站留言短信通知 源码怎么设置

图片来源于网络,如有侵权联系删除

(1)查询数据库,获取最新的网站留言信息。

(2)将留言信息以短信形式发送给管理员。

(3)记录短信发送记录,便于后续查询。

6、系统部署

将开发好的网站留言短信通知系统部署到服务器上,确保系统稳定运行。

系统测试

1、功能测试:测试网站留言功能、短信发送功能和通知功能,确保各项功能正常运行。

2、性能测试:测试系统在高并发情况下的性能表现,确保系统稳定可靠。

3、安全测试:测试系统在遭受攻击时的安全性,确保用户数据安全。

本文详细介绍了基于Python的网站留言短信通知系统源码,包括系统概述、技术选型、实现步骤和系统测试等方面,通过本系统,管理员可以及时了解网站留言情况,提高工作效率,在实际应用中,可根据需求对系统进行扩展和优化,以满足更多场景的需求。

标签: #网站留言短信通知 源码

黑狐家游戏
  • 评论列表

留言评论